Follow the writing process, whatever you're writing!
Prewriting: brainstorm, research, plan, outline, thesis statement -- If you don't have a thesis statement and outline yet, stop right now and do those steps; do not proceed without them.
Writing: write first draft by starting with section II of your outline; write introduction after the body of the paper is written; write the conclusion last.
Polishing: revise, concentrating first on the body of the paper, then the intro, then the concl (revision = making sure ideas are logical and sequential and support your thesis); proofread (spelling, grammar, usage, etc.)
